Eyes Rutherford and Kanone Hilbert from Spiral: The Bonds of Reasoning will always be one of my favourite canonically platonic duos. I really enjoy character relations that are deep and fulfilling, and that transcend the need for words-- understanding via silence indicates trust. There are many different forms of trust, and not all of them are positive. Kanone and Eyes trust each other implicitly-- whether they are on the same side or different sides, Eyes trusts Kanone to be himself, and vice-versa. The two of them complement each other's weaknesses and strengths. Eyes is the strategic backbone of the Blade Children; Kanone is the weapon. Eyes refuses to cry anymore, and so Kanone will cry in his stead. They do this without needing to communicate-- during the phone-call prelude to Kanone's intention of holding an entire school hostage in order to kill the Blade Children basically nothing was said-- but the silence said so, so much more.
